HARRISON, WI (WTAQ-WLUK) — The public restrooms at a Harrison park will be locked until further notice due to repeated incidents of vandalism.
Darboy Community Park staff say over the past three weeks, they’ve had to address vandalism involving feces being spread on the walls of the public restrooms.
A porta-potty will be provided for general park visitors.
The public restrooms will be available only for scheduled park rentals.
